目录前言一、什么是Cookie?二、Cookie的作用三、Cookie的工作原理四、使用Cookie存储数据1.创建Cookie对象Cookie的常用方法2.将Cookie对象写入响应3.从请求中读取Cookie数据五、Cookie禁用后sessionId如何传递URL重写技术六、Cookie的应用——实现自动登录七、Cookie和Session的区别相同点不同点由于一系列原因: 没有将Cooki
转载
2023-09-25 21:25:12
55阅读
使用spring-session时,动态修改cookie的max-age不论是使用spring提供的spring-session,还是使用servle容器实现的http session。原理都是把session-id以cookie的形式存储在客户端。每次请求都带上cookie。服务器通过session-id,找到session。spring-session的使用由“记住我”引发的一个问题用户登录的
转载
2024-05-02 22:05:52
81阅读
cookie :是用户保存在用户浏览器端的一对键值对,是为了解决http的无状态连接。服务端是可以把 cookie写到用户浏览器上,用户每次发请求会携带cookie。
存放位置:
每次发请求cookie是放在请求头里面的。
应用场景:
·登陆用户和密码的记住密码
转载
2023-07-17 23:47:29
64阅读
Python Cookie 读取和保存方法如下所示:#保存 cookie 到变量
import urllib.request
import http.cookiejar
cookie = http.cookiejar.CookieJar()
handler = urllib.request.HTTPCookieProcessor(cookie)
opener = urllib.request.bu
转载
2023-07-02 10:56:57
59阅读
方法一通过python的requests包:importrequests
url="https://fanyi.baidu.com"
res=requests.get(url)
ck=res.cookies
print(ck)
print(type(ck))
print(ck.keys())# 获取cookie中所有键名,以list格式输出
print(ck.items())
# 输出
,]>
转载
2023-11-21 19:16:45
145阅读
在用python 写爬虫的时候,经常需要获取cookies,然后才能开始其他的一起爬取操作。这里整理下,网上一些的资料。在这里我们以豆瓣网 https://accounts.douban.com/passport/login为例。方法1:python3+requests库获取:import requests
from requests.cookies import RequestsCookieJa
转载
2023-06-27 18:17:23
883阅读
Cookies基础cookie数据长什么样: 清除浏览器历史数据 登录豆瓣查看cookies数据 查看第一个请求,这里是比较干净的,它没有cookie,应答也没有cookie,应答码是301,实际请求是location这个地方,所以我们的浏览器发送了第二个请求。 第二个请求里面也没有cookie,但是它的应答包含了Set-cookie,这比较像我们的浏览器保存了两条数据,每一条cookie
转载
2023-10-01 08:28:17
488阅读
方法中,url必须是无一个dns查询的url,不能够包含Url中的子目录;比如www.baidu.com是一个有效的url,而 www.baidu.com/file/ 就不是一个有效的urlpost的时候header中的refer那个参数很重要。def get(self, url, searchDepartureAirport=None, searchArrivalAirport=None, s
转载
2024-08-12 10:50:27
32阅读
我们用python写网站的自动登录程序的时候需要创建一个cookies,我们可以利用python的cooklib模块。比如:#coding:utf-8
import urllib,urllib2,cookielib
cj = cookielib.LWPCookieJar()
opener = urllib2.build_opener(urllib2.HTTPCookieProcessor(cj)
转载
2023-05-26 23:59:54
689阅读
1. Cookie为什么要使用Cookie呢?Cookie,指某些网站为了辨别用户身份、进行session跟踪而储存在用户本地终端上的数据(通常经过加密)比如说有些网站需要登录后才能访问某个页面,在登录之前,你想抓取某个页面内容是不允许的。那么我们可以利用Urllib库保存我们登录的Cookie,然后再抓取其他页面就达到目的了。1.1 Opener当你获取一个URL你使用一个opener(一个ur
转载
2023-12-24 12:48:31
36阅读
前言 Cookie,指某些网站为了辨别用户身份、进行session跟踪而储存在用户本地终端上的数据(通常经过加密)。 有些网站需要登录后才能访问某个页面,比如知乎的回答,QQ空间的好友列表、微博上关注的人和粉丝等,在登录之前,你想抓取某个页面内容是不允许的。那么我们可以利用某些库保存我们登录后的Cookie,然后爬虫使用保存的Cookie可以打开网页进行相关爬取,此时该页面仍然以为是我们人为的
转载
2023-11-21 16:50:46
231阅读
Cookie,指某些网站为了辨别用户身份、进行session跟踪而储存在用户本地终端上的数据(通常经过加密) 比如说有些网站需要登录后才能访问某个页面,在登录之前,你想抓取某个页面内容是不允许的。那么我们可以利用Urllib2库保存我们登录的Cookie,然后再抓取其他页面就达到目的了。 在此之前呢,我们必须先介绍一个opener的概念。 1.Opener 当你获取一个URL你使用一个open
转载
2023-09-15 08:58:31
172阅读
Python爬虫教程-12-爬虫使用cookie(上)爬虫关于cookie和session,由于http协议无记忆性,比如说登录淘宝网站的浏览记录,下次打开是不能直接记忆下来的,后来就有了cookie和session机制Python爬虫爬取登录后的页面所以怎样让爬虫使用验证用户身份信息的cookie呢,换句话说,怎样在使用爬虫的时候爬取已经登录的页面呢,这就是本篇的重点cookie和session
转载
2024-02-05 20:05:14
34阅读
python3 cookbook 第四章前言手动遍历迭代器代理迭代使用生成器创建新的迭代模式实现迭代器协议反向迭代带有外部状态的生成器函数迭代器切片跳过可迭代对象的开始部分排列组合的迭代序列上索引值迭代同时迭代多个序列不同集合上元素的迭代创建数据处理管道展开嵌套的序列顺序迭代合并后的排序迭代对象迭代器代替while无限循环 前言这章节讲的是迭代器和生成器,学习之前可以看一下这个回答,先复习下可迭
转载
2023-08-20 20:43:38
111阅读
前言最近在学习 Python 网络编程,已经实现了简单的服务器和浏览器的信息交互。正在进一步学习 Cookie 和 Session(可能还有 Token),所以写一篇随笔来加深自己的理解。 一、Cookie 是什么Cookie,有时也用其复数形式 Cookies,指某些网站为了辨别用户身份、进行 Session 跟踪而储存在用户本地终端上的数据(通常经过加密)。【来源:百度百科
转载
2023-07-01 14:18:13
92阅读
环境操作系统:windows 10 x64 集成环境:Visual Studio Code Python版本:v3.10.5 64位 – 解码需要os、sqlite3、win32crypt、base64、cryptography、json库 – 访问网页需要urllib、http库一、说明这篇博文是一篇解题思路的记述文章,代码也是按照解决问题的思路一路写下去的,所以基本不存在函数、类等可
转载
2024-08-10 10:53:45
46阅读
# 初学者指南:如何在 Python 中设置 Cookie
在 Web 开发中,Cookie 是一种重要的机制,用于在客户端保存用户的状态。了解如何在 Python 中设置 Cookie 将为你在 Web 开发上打下坚实的基础。本文将指导你完成设置 Cookie 的过程。
## 流程概述
在设置 Cookie 时,我们通常遵循以下步骤:
| 步骤 | 描述
# 使用 Python 处理 Cookies——以 Boos 的 Cookie 为例
Cookies 在 Web 开发中扮演着非常重要的角色。它们是由服务器创建并存储在用户的浏览器上的小数据块。Cookies 可以用于保存用户的登录状态、用户偏好以及跟踪用户在网站上的行为等。在 Python 的网络编程中,我们也可以非常方便地处理 Cookies。本文将以 Boos 的 Cookie 为例,介绍
原创
2024-08-29 05:02:53
62阅读
# Spring Boot中为对应的JSESSIONID设置Cookie
在基于Java的Web应用中,Session管理是一个重要的部分。Spring Boot为我们提供了便利的方式来处理Session。在Spring Boot中,JSESSIONID是用于辨识用户会话的标准Cookie,通常由Servlet容器自动管理。不过,有时候我们需要手动处理Cookie,特别是在需要自定义Cookie
原创
2024-10-07 04:58:14
757阅读
python爬虫学习5_cookie的获取、保存和使用Cookie,指某些网站为了辨别用户身份、进行session跟踪而储存在用户本地终端上的数据(通常经过加密)。 比如说有些网站需要登录后才能访问某个页面,在登录之前,你想抓取某个页面内容,登陆前与登陆后是不同的,或者不允许的。在python中它为我们提供了cookiejar模块,它位于http包中,用于对Cookie的支持。通过它我们能捕获co
转载
2023-08-30 18:32:23
142阅读